Care guide for preserved flowers in Edina

Edina falls in the low-humidity care range: indoor humidity is estimated to exceed 52% for only about 36% of the year. The arrangement can generally stay on the indoor surface you prefer without special protection from color transfer. Keep the flowers indoors and out of direct sunlight. They can last up to three years, and a dimmer spot may help them last longer. Temperature is a minor care factor in Edina: the hottest month averages about 84°F, while prolonged heat above 91.4°F occurs during 0% of the year.

Which seasonal flowers suit Edina's growing zone?

For Edina in USDA zone 5a, the seasonal list moves from Daffodils, Tulips, Irises, and Peonies in spring to Roses, Hydrangeas, Coneflowers, and Daylilies in summer, Asters, Chrysanthemums, Sedum, and Goldenrod in fall, and Hellebores, Winter Heath, Paperwhites, and Evergreen Holly in winter. Weather and site conditions can shift the schedule.
